summ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orRavi Nagarajan <nravi@broadcom.com>2012-06-29 19:18:07 +0530
committerMatthew Xie <mattx@google.com>2012-07-26 19:20:32 -0700
commit82e57fe1741e225a65bc69004ae12cbbdfae5737 (patch)
tree27c141dff0fac9e65f4560082e7456ba6adfd1f5
parentc61eb2617df72f1e58d23e4c27897efedcfc0a09 (diff)
downloadframeworks_base-82e57fe1741e225a65bc69004ae12cbbdfae5737.zip
frameworks_base-82e57fe1741e225a65bc69004ae12cbbdfae5737.tar.gz
frameworks_base-82e57fe1741e225a65bc69004ae12cbbdfae5737.tar.bz2
Reset priority on unbond
Change-Id: I8232c666bde26235ad527c96e5218fc1b3e7a1db
-rwxr-xr-xcore/java/android/bluetooth/BluetoothA2dp.java1
-rwxr-xr-xcore/java/android/bluetooth/BluetoothHeadset.java1
2 files changed, 2 insertions, 0 deletions
diff --git a/core/java/android/bluetooth/BluetoothA2dp.java b/core/java/android/bluetooth/BluetoothA2dp.java
index 74f634b..1b415e5 100755
--- a/core/java/android/bluetooth/BluetoothA2dp.java
+++ b/core/java/android/bluetooth/BluetoothA2dp.java
@@ -338,6 +338,7 @@ public final class BluetoothA2dp implements BluetoothProfile {
&& isValidDevice(device)) {
if (priority != BluetoothProfile.PRIORITY_OFF &&
priority != BluetoothProfile.PRIORITY_ON &&
+ priority != BluetoothProfile.PRIORITY_UNDEFINED &&
priority != BluetoothProfile.PRIORITY_AUTO_CONNECT) {
return false;
}
diff --git a/core/java/android/bluetooth/BluetoothHeadset.java b/core/java/android/bluetooth/BluetoothHeadset.java
index 75dfe9d..8e6ebaf 100755
--- a/core/java/android/bluetooth/BluetoothHeadset.java
+++ b/core/java/android/bluetooth/BluetoothHeadset.java
@@ -456,6 +456,7 @@ public final class BluetoothHeadset implements BluetoothProfile {
isValidDevice(device)) {
if (priority != BluetoothProfile.PRIORITY_OFF &&
priority != BluetoothProfile.PRIORITY_ON &&
+ priority != BluetoothProfile.PRIORITY_UNDEFINED &&
priority != BluetoothProfile.PRIORITY_AUTO_CONNECT) {
return false;
}